Rabbit anti-Human NEUROG1 Polyclonal Antibody

The antibody against NEUROG1 was raised in Rabbit using the recombinant fusion protein containing a sequence corresponding to amino acids 1-237 of human NEUROG1 (Q92886) as the immunogen. The polyclonal antibody exists as a isotype IgG, by affinity purification. This antibody has been validated on WB, ELISA.

  • Target Function

    Acts as a transcriptional regulator. Involved in the initiation of neuronal differentiation. Activates transcription by binding to the E box (5'-CANNTG-3'). Associates with chromatin to enhancer regulatory elements in genes encoding key transcriptional regulators of neurogenesis.

  • Target Subcellular Location

    Nucleus.

  • Target Tissue Specificity

    Expression restricted to the embryonic nervous system.

  • Target Background

    Enables E-box binding activity and protein homodimerization activity. Involved in several processes, including animal organ morphogenesis; cranial nerve development; and hard palate morphogenesis. Predicted to be located in neuronal cell body. Predicted to be part of chromatin. Predicted to be active in nucleus.
